N Building is a commercial structure located near Tachikawa station amidst a shopping district. Being a commercial building signs or billboards are typically attached to its facade which we feel undermines the structures' identity. As a solution we thought to use a QR Code as the facade itself. By reading the QR Code with your mobile device you will be taken to a site which includes up to date shop information. In this manner we envision a cityscape unhindered by ubiquitous signage and also an improvement to the quality and accuracy of the information itself.

PTAM (Robotics Research Group, University of Oxford) 2007 desktop, environment tracking and mapping, videofeed, animation or still, single user, 360 small field of view, no narrative, anywhere, ISMAR, research project
Video results for an Augmented Reality tracking system. A computer tracks a camera and works out a map of the environment in realtime, and this can be used to overlay virtual graphics. Presented at the ISMAR 2007 conference.

Sgraffito in 3D Joachim Rotteveel (AR+RFID LAB) 2008 desktop, graphic image recognition, marker logo's, still, multi-user, small field of view, reactive to marker position, still, in front of any computer with camera, museum, informative, educational, history
rom October 25, 2008 until January 4, 2009 the Museum Boijmans van Beuningen in Rotterdam was exhibiting its wonderful collection of sgraffito objects from the period 1450-1550. Sgraffito is an ancient decorative technique in which patterns are scratched into the wet clay. The Dutch plates, bowls and cooking pots are part of the Van Beuningen-De Vriese collection. The artist Joachim Rotteveel has made this archaeological collection accessible in a spectacular way using 3D reconstruction techniques from the worlds of medicine and industry, including AR application provided by the AR+RFID Lab.
The Haunted Book Camille Scherrer (EPFL CVLab) 2009 desktop, graphic image recognition, graphic images, animation, multi/single user, small field of view, reactive to object position, linear narrative, user can turn the page and start animation, in front of any computer with webcam, poetry, book, student work, markerless
Diploma project by an ECAL Media & Interaction Design student with the EPFL CVLab. An artwork that relies on recent Computer Vision and Augmented Reality techniques to animate the illustrations of a poetry book. Because we don't need markers, we can achieve seamless integration of real and virtual elements to create the desired atmosphere. The visualization is done on a computer screen to avoid cumbersome Head-Mounted Displays. The camera is hidden into a desk lamp for easing even more the spectator immersion.

Triceratops Georg Klein (University of Oxford) 2009 handheld screen, envoirenment mapping, video, still image, semi multi-user due to large screen, 360 choice of perspective, small field of view, reactive to hand position, still, informational about the physical object, after mapping, space-specific, natural museum oxford, museum, education, informational
University of Oxford Natural History Museum Augmented Reality Tour. A map is made around a triceratops skull in the museum and an AR model is added. This work extends Georg Klein's Parallel Tracking and Mapping system to allow it to use multiple independent cameras and multiple maps. This allows maps of multiple workspaces to be made and individual augmented reality applications associated with each. As the user explores the world the system is able to automatically relocalize into previously mapped areas.

[syn]aesthetics_09 Halvor Høgset 2009 handheld display, shape recognition, markers, videofeed, animation and sound, multi-user, 360 small field of view, reacts to hands position, linear narrative, anywhere indoors, long setup, XGA, Galleri ROM
The installation uses the whole exhibition space, and consists of 3 handheld monitors (1 cordless and 2 with cable) equipped with progressive XGA video cameras, headphones and buttons for interaction. Through these monitors the users explore the space, augmented with digital structures and spatialized sounds, and interact with them in a real-time experience.
